Healthspan Summit lands its strongest sponsor lineup yet for 2026
The Healthspan Summit named sponsors for its Oct. 2-3 event in Los Angeles, with partners spanning regenerative medicine, laser therapy, nutrigenomics, payments compliance, skincare and concierge care. Organizers say the lineup reflects a push for more evidence-based, clinically credible companies in the longevity space.
Why it matters: - The Healthspan Summit is positioning itself as a filter for longevity companies that can back up their claims with evidence and clinical rigor. - The sponsor mix points to growing demand for practical tools in regenerative medicine, health-business payments, personalized care and performance-focused treatments. - The event is aimed at physicians, clinic owners and med spa leaders looking for vetted products and operator-level education.
What happened: - The Healthspan Summit announced its 2026 sponsor lineup on Sept. 16. - The fourth annual summit runs Oct. 2-3 in Los Angeles. - The event will span more than 40,000 square feet and feature over 50 speakers and 50 curated exhibitors. - The summit will use five dedicated zones: the Horizon Stage, the Nexus, the Innovation Hall, the Vitality Zone and the BeautySpan Studio. - The summit opened a limited Sponsor-Supported Access Window for attendees. - Tickets start at $179 and rise after Sept. 22. - Ticket information is available at get tickets.
The details: - Summus Medical Laser sponsors the Horizon Stage with its evidence-based Class IV laser therapy. - Regen Therapy sponsors the Innovation Hall and plans to showcase its regenerative treatments with clinical team members available for practitioner questions. - Routine Skin joins as a sponsor with a skincare line rooted in peptide research, including work on GHK-Cu. - Luqra sponsors the Nexus and will lead a session on building a payments strategy for health businesses from the ground up. - SNiP Nutrigenomics returns as an official sponsor focused on genetic precision in supplementation. - ConciergeMD sponsors the VIP ticket tier and will extend physician-led, personalized care through concierge touchpoints. - Exhibitors were vetted for evidence-based science, quality control and clinical or economic utility. - The Nexus track is designed to add tactical, operator-level education alongside the summit's broader programming.
